Inclusion criteria

Inclusion criteria: All patients undergoing primary total knee arthroplasty during study period

Exclusion criteria

Exclusion criteria: allergy to tranexamic acid; preoperative hepatic or renal dysfunction; preoperative use of anticoagular medication seven days prior to surgery; history of fibrinolytic disorder or blood dyscrasia; cerebrovascular accident, myocardial infarction, New York heart association class III or IV heart failure, atrial fibrillation, history of deep vein thrombosis or pulmonary embolus, preoperative INR >1.4, aPTT >1.4 x normal, platelets <140000/mm3.
